Safeguarding and Wellbeing Officer
Term time, 38 week per annum
Part time, 25 hours per week
Salary: £15,062 per annum (£26,527 pro rata)
Burton on Trent, Town Centre Campus
Who are we looking for?
The current BSDC Safeguarding team strive to ensure all College learners are safe, happy and protected. We are seeking a new member of the team to act as first point of contact for any learner safeguarding need. You will also take part in College wide safeguarding such as staff or learner training, reports, admin and meeting attendance.
The successful applicant will be required to have excellent communication skills and work cohesively as a team and with parents, young people and other professionals.
We are keen that the successful candidate is passionate about helping young people and adults, and has experience working with vulnerable people to positively improve outcomes.
You will need to have compassion and empathy and be able to hold sensitive and challenging conversations with others. You will receive ongoing support and guidance within the team throughout your role.
A Level 2 qualification in Safeguarding is essential, or a willingness to work towards this.
Applicants should be qualified to, or willing to work towards, Level 2 English and Maths. Evidence of qualifications is required.
